Bianca Censori is launching her awaited new project. The architect, media personality, and wife of Kanye West hosted an event in Seoul, South Korea, where she launched some of the products available for purchase, introducing her list of products via performance art. Through it all, she wore a skintight maroon bodysuit that covered her from her neck down to her maroon high heels.
Censori's project is called BIO POP, and kicked off last night, with a performance announced a day prior. Photos and images from the event were shared online, showing a group of models wearing nude bodysuits in a white room.
The models contorted their bodies throughout the clips, acting as living furniture. One clip shows Censori in her bodysuit, walking inside the room as she holds a silver tray with its cover. Censori placed the tray on the table in front of her, sitting down on one of the chairs.
Censori's website features explanations of what appear to be her upcoming exhibits, which are scheduled through 2032, bearing titles and descriptions.
"Bianca Censori’s first work, BIO POP, stages the body inside the language of the domestic. She begins in a kitchen, baking a cake, before carrying it into a dining room where women - masked, dark-haired doubles of herself - are restrained inside her sculptural furniture," reads a part of the project's description.
Censori is also selling different jewelry items on her website, which appear to be inspired by medical equipment, like different variations of speculum cuffs, with one priced at $2,250, a scalpel bracelet, priced at $2,100, and more. All of the products were designed by her.
Censori's career as an architect
While Bianca Censori has become a popular figure due to her bold fashion choices and decisions, she's originally an architect. She was originally an architectural designer at Yeezy, the media brand and luxury fashion label created by West.
